Jaidin's usage pattern, beyond the headline number

Splitting Jaidin's full recorded timeline at 2010, 39% of its total births fall in the more recent half of the record versus 61% in the earlier half -- the name was more prevalent in its earlier era than it is today. Its quietest year on record was 2019, with just 5 recorded births -- worth weighing against the 2008 peak of 27 to see the full range of the name's swing in popularity.
